Linux
[Linux] java17 설치
개발에목마른쭌
2023. 5. 31. 09:54
- yum -y install wget curl
- cd /tmp
- rm -rf /opt/jdk-17
- jdk 17 다운로드
- Linux 64-bit
- wget https://download.java.net/java/GA/jdk17.0.2/dfd4a8d0985749f896bed50d7138ee7f/8/GPL/openjdk-17.0.2_linux-x64_bin.tar.gz
- 이걸 선택하시면 됩니다, 본인의 PC가 M1 인거랑 상관없습니다.
- wget https://download.java.net/java/GA/jdk17.0.2/dfd4a8d0985749f896bed50d7138ee7f/8/GPL/openjdk-17.0.2_linux-x64_bin.tar.gz
- Linux ARM64
- wget https://download.java.net/java/GA/jdk17.0.2/dfd4a8d0985749f896bed50d7138ee7f/8/GPL/openjdk-17.0.2_linux-aarch64_bin.tar.gz
- 본인의 PC가 M1 인것과 상관없습니다.
- NCP 에서 CentOS7 을 ARM64 버전으로 설치한 경우에만 이걸로 설치해 주세요.
- wget https://download.java.net/java/GA/jdk17.0.2/dfd4a8d0985749f896bed50d7138ee7f/8/GPL/openjdk-17.0.2_linux-aarch64_bin.tar.gz
- Linux 64-bit
- tar -xvf openjdk-17.0.2_linux-x64_bin.tar.gz
- mv jdk-17.0.2/ /opt/jdk-17/
- vi ~/.bashrc
- 프로파일에 JAVA_HOME 변수와 PATH를 설정한다.(bash 쉘 기준)
- .bashrc 내용
# .bashrc
# User specific aliases and functions
alias rm='rm -i'
alias cp='cp -i'
alias mv='mv -i'
export JAVA_HOME=/opt/jdk-17 # 추가
export PATH=$JAVA_HOME/bin:$PATH # 추가
# Source global definitions
if [ -f /etc/bashrc ]; then
. /etc/bashrc
fi
- source ~/.bashrc
- 수정된 프로파일을 시스템에 반영한다.
- java -version
- JDK 설치 확인